Homeowner’s Issue

Burien yards face a mix of heavy winter rainfall, compact clay-silt soils, and pockets of shade from maples and firs that encourage moss and ivy regrowth. Slopes toward Puget Sound and small drainage challenges near gutters or downspouts can leave beds waterlogged or wash mulch away. For landlords and homeowners near Seahurst Park or Lake Burien, common goals are tidy curb appeal, durable low-maintenance beds for tenants, and safe sightlines for driveways and walkways. Post-bloom trimming addresses spent flowers and overgrowth that trap moisture, reduces disease pressure, and prevents plants from setting invasive seed. Using sustainable, non-chemical practices keeps beds healthier year-round and reduces time spent between maintenance visits.

Before & After / Expectations

After trimming, expect neater beds, fewer seed heads, and quicker drying after rain. New growth can appear within 2–4 weeks in active perennials and shrubs.

Care tips:

  • Water deeply only if dry for two weeks
  • Pull small weeds early; moss benefits from improved light and aeration
  • Monitor ivy regrowth on shaded north-facing walls
